A Brief History Of Memory Foam

Visco elastic polyurethane foam, also known as memory foam, is a relatively new invention. At least for the non-IT or consumer electronics industries. This interesting material is actually a type of foam, but a very dense foam. Its most obvious ability is that it temporarily retains the shape of anything that you press into it. But its most useful ability is somewhat less obvious - memory foam is very, very good at distributing pressure.

This is, after all, the task that NASA had it developed to perform in the 1960s. Officially, it was invented to improve the safety of aircraft cushions. "Coincidentally", memory foam was invented in time for the Apollo project to send men to the moon. Sending men into space inside rockets required that those rockets be accelerated very fast. The great force exerted presses the astronauts against their seats very strongly. But to send men to the moon required an even more powerful rocket than had ever been used before - the Saturn V - still considered the most powerful rocket developed by Man. The acceleration was practically unimaginable, and memory foam cushions would help to spread the pressure of the forces pressing the astronauts back against their seats. Instead of having the pressure concentrated in certain locations where the body met the surface of the cushion (as in older materials), the memory foam distributed the forces throughout the seat.

This ability to redistribute pressure and hence reduce the forces reacting against the human body resting on it also makes memory foam ideal for use in hospital beds where patients had to lie immobile for long periods of time. While normal beds caused bedsores and water beds were expensive to maintain, memory foam mattresses were relatively economical for what they did. That is not to say that memory foam mattresses were cheap. They were not. However, they were cheaper than the previously used technology - water beds.

Why Memory Foam Toppers Help You Sleep Better

Obviously, what was good for these immobile patients is even better for someone who is healthy. This property of removing pressure from whatever was placed on top of it makes memory foam mattresses tremendously comfortable to lie on. So when NASA finally released their patents to the public domain in the 1980s, Fagerdala World Foams was one of the first companies which quickly ran with it - making a wide range of their beds, mattresses and pillows. Today, the Tempur memory foam mattress topper and Tempurpedic memory foam pillow are among some of their most famous products for the bedroom.

The great advantage of the Tempurpedic memory foam topper for an insomniac is that you do feel almost no pressure pressing back against you when you lie on it. This behavior is very different from that of conventional mattresses. At the same time, it provides proper support for your back, helping to preserve the healthy curvature and alignment of your spine. This is something most normal beds cannot do ... at least not both at the same time. These factors make sleeping on a memory foam topper very comfortable indeed - exactly like sleeping in a very soft bed. And yet, unlike a soft bed, you do not wake up with a sore back because your spine is well-supported - just like sleeping on a hard mattress. But the memory foam mattress pad is not a hard mattress. Somehow it manages to be both firm and soft at the same time.
